Federal law enforcement official confirms extortion plot involving Natalee Holloway's mother

(CNN) - A federal law enforcement official confirms the FBI paid Joran Van der Sloot $25,000 in an undercover investigation of a plot to extort money from Natalee Holloway's mother, Beth Holloway. The source familiar with the case said the FBI and U.S. Attorneys Office in Alabama arranged for a meeting where an undercover agent paid Van der Sloot $10,000 in cash and another $15,000 in a wire transfer for his information on the location of Holloway's body in Aruba.

Van der Sloot then was able to leave Aruba and travel to Peru. The federal official rejected a suggestion that U.S. officials were slow in moving against van der Sloot. The official said authorities were intent on learning if the body was located so they could assist Aruba officials in bringing murder charges.
